Transaction 21e146cc2057a34da0e7dd09c1e19af3f92ac624f1450075a672df566956e419
1 Input
2 Outputs
- 21e146cc2057a34da0e7dd09c1e19af3f92ac624f1450075a672df566956e419:0
- 21e146cc2057a34da0e7dd09c1e19af3f92ac624f1450075a672df566956e419:1
value 103000
address 37LUYhgj26EDYskbe7JzRH8tVkhpX5it8D
value 141216
address 15TCYWLjPpzscv2BLRC9Wiy1jbudyw5x5e